Essential Site Preparation Steps
Proper site preparation is essential for a successful concrete installation process. To begin, the area must be cleared of debris, vegetation, and any existing structures. This step guarantees a clean, stable foundation. Following this, the soil is evaluated for compaction and drainage capabilities; if necessary, it may be compacted or treated to increase st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also essential, as they define the shape and dimensions of the concrete pour. Lastly, reinforcing materials, such as rebar or wire mesh, are positioned to strengthen the concrete's strength. Proper execution of these steps lays the groundwork for a long-lasting and reliable concrete structure.
The Significance of Proper Curing
Despite being often ignored, the curing process fulfills a critical purpose in the success of a concrete installation. This phase initiates promptly once the concrete is poured and entails keeping adequate moisture, temperature, and time to allow the concrete to achieve its intended strength and durability. Proper curing avoids problems like cracking, surface scaling, and weaknesses in the material. Techniques may include placing over the surface wet burlap, applying curing compounds, or applying plastic sheeting to maintain moisture levels. Typically, the curing period lasts from a few days to several weeks, based on environmental conditions and the specific concrete mix used. Understanding the significance of this process guarantees that the final structure remains reliable and long-lasting, meeting the expectations of clients.

Consistent Cleaning Techniques
Regular maintenance routines are necessary for sustaining the long-term condition and aesthetics of concrete surfaces. Regular upkeep, such as clearing debris and dirt, aids in preventing staining and deterioration. Power cleaning efficiently eliminates tough stains, algae, or moss that may accumulate over time. It is suggested to use a gentle cleaning solution during this process to avoid chemical damage. Additionally, promptly dealing with spills, particularly from oil or chemicals, can inhibit permanent discoloration. In freezing environments, clearing snow and ice is essential to stop cracking due to freeze-thaw cycles. Periodic examinations for cracks or surface wear can also assist in identifying issues early, ensuring that concrete surfaces remain resilient and good-looking for years to come.
How Often to Apply Sealant
Generally, putting on a sealant to concrete surfaces every one through three years is important for upholding their durability and aesthetics. This frequency is based on factors such as weather conditions, foot traffic, and the type of sealant used. Consistent inspections can help determine when reapplication is necessary; indicators like discoloration, wear, or water penetration demonstrate that the sealant has worn away. Homeowners should choose premium sealants made for their specific concrete applications, providing better durability. In addition, proper surface preparation before application improves adhesion and effectiveness. By sticking to this maintenance schedule, property owners can safeguard their concrete investments, lengthening the lifespan of surfaces and limiting costly repairs in the future.
Future Developments and Innovations in Advanced Concrete Methods
In what ways is the concrete sector adapting to address the needs of an increasingly dynamic world? Advancements in concrete technology are shaping a more sustainable and robust future. Researchers are developing environmentally friendly alternatives, such as recycled aggregates and bio-based additives, which decrease the carbon footprint of concrete production. Additionally, advancements in smart concrete—integrating sensors that monitor structural health—enable proactive maintenance, boosting safety and longevity.
Yet another growing trend is the application of 3D printing technology, facilitating fast construction of complex structures with minimal waste. Furthermore, self-healing concrete, which utilizes bacteria or alternative materials to repair cracks autonomously, is building traction, delivering extended-life infrastructure systems.
As urban expansion continues and climate change influences building practices, these developments illustrate the industry's focus on sustainability and efficiency. The future of concrete technology offers significant promise for transforming how society builds, providing structures that are resilient and environmentally sustainable.

How Long Does Concrete Typically Take to Cure Completely?
Concrete typically takes about 28 days to cure completely, although initial setting occurs within several hours. Elements including temperature, humidity, and mix design can influence the curing process and overall strength development.
What Concrete Finish Options Are Available?
Various concrete finishes feature polished, stamped, exposed aggregate, brushed, and troweled. Every single finish features distinct aesthetics and textures, meeting different design preferences and functional requirements in home and business applications.
Can Concrete Be Successfully Poured in Cold Weather?
Indeed, concrete can be placed in cold weather, but specific precautions are necessary. Appropriate techniques and materials, such as heated water and insulating blankets, help guarantee the concrete cures successfully despite lower temperatures.
How Should I Handle Cracked Concrete?
When concrete develops cracks, evaluate the severity of the damage. Small fissures can be filled with a concrete patching compound, while larger cracks could necessitate professional evaluation and repair to guarantee structural integrity and prevent further issues.
